Simple Past Tense: The simple past tense is used to denote an action which was completed in the past.

Simple Past = use of V2

Rules: 
  • With most verbs, the simple past is created simply by adding “ed “.
Example: 
  1. Play – Played
  2. Look – Looked
  • If a regular verb ends with “ e “ add only “ d “ for both the past tense and past participle.
Example:
  1. Like – Liked
  2. Live – Lived
  • For short, one-syllable verbs that end with consonant + vowel + consonant (CVC), we must double the last consonant and then add “ed “.
Example:
  1. Stop – Stopped
  2. Rub – Rubbed
  • When a verb ends with “ y “ and there is a consonant before it, the “ y “ changes into “ i “ then the letter “ ed “ is added.
Example:
  1. Cry – Cried
  2. Study – Studied
  • When a verb ends with “y “, and there is a vowel before it, we simply add the letter “ed “ to the verb.
Example:
  1. Play – Played
Formula:

Positive: Subject + V2 + object
Negative: Subject + did + not + V1 + object
Interrogative: Did + subject + V1 + object
Nag. Int.: Did + not + subject + V1 + object

Example:

पूजाने अपने पुराने दोस्तों को याद किया ।
Positive: Pooja remembered her old friends.
Negative: Pooja didn’t remember her old friends.
Interrogative: Did Pooja remember her old friends?
Neg. Int.: Didn’t Pooja remember her old friend?

भास्करने पिछले हफ्ते अपनी दूकान का उद्घाटन किया ।
Positive: Bhaskar inaugurated his shop last week.
Negative: Bhaskar didn’t inaugurate his shop last week.
Interrogative: Did Bhaskar inaugurate his shop last week?
Neg. Int.: Didn’t Bhaskar inaugurate his shop last week?

पिछले महीने भारत मेच जीत गया था ।
Positive: India won the match last month.
Negative: India didn’t win the match last month.
Interrogative: Did India win the match last month?
Neg. Int.: Didn’t India win the match last month?
